api是什么的缩写 api是什么( 二 )
这些优秀的可视化编程环境操作简单,界面友好(如VB、VC++、DELPHI等 。).这些工具提供了大量的类库和各种控件,取代了API的神秘功能 。其实这些类库和控件都是基于WIN32 API函数的,是封装的API函数的集合 。他们将自己常用的API函数组合成一个控件或类库,并赋予其方便的使用方式,从而大大加快了WINDOWS应用程序开发的进程 。有了这些控件和类库,程序员可以专注于程序整体功能的设计,而不必过多关注技术细节 。事实上,如果我们想要开发更加灵活、实用、高效的应用程序,就必须直接使用API函数 。虽然类库和控件使应用程序的开发变得容易得多,但它们只提供了WINDOWS的一般功能 。对于复杂特殊的函数,使用类库和控件是非常困难的,需要API函数来实现 。
API有四种类型:远程过程调用(RPC):程序之间的通信是通过作用于共享数据缓冲区的进程(或任务)来实现的 。标准查询语言(SQL):是访问数据的标准查询语言,通过通用数据库实现应用程序间的数据共享 。文件传输:文件传输通过发送格式化文件实现应用程序之间的数据共享 。信息传递:指松耦合或紧耦合的应用程序之间的小型格式化信息,通过应用程序之间的直接通信实现数据共享 。目前应用于API的标准是ANSI标准SQL API 。其他类型的标准仍在制定中 。API可以应用于所有的计算机平台和操作系统 。这些API连接不同格式的数据(例如共享数据缓冲区、数据库结构和文件框架) 。每种数据格式都需要不同的数据命令和参数来实现正确的数据通信,但也会产生不同类型的错误 。因此,除了执行数据共享任务所需的知识,这些类型的API还必须解决许多网络参数问题和可能的错误条件,即每个应用程序都必须知道自己是否具有强大的性能来支持程序之间的通信 。相反,这个API只处理一种信息格式,所以这种情况下的信息传递API只提供命令、网络参数和错误条件的一个小的子集 。正因为如此,交付API大大降低了系统的复杂度,所以当应用需要跨多个平台共享数据时,采用信息交付API类型是一个理想的选择 。它与API图形用户界面(GUI)或命令界面有很大区别:API界面属于一个操作系统或程序界面,而后两者属于直接用户界面 。有时公司使用API作为他们的公共开放系统 。也就是说,公司制定自己的系统接口标准,公司所有成员在需要做系统集成、定制、程序应用等操作时,都可以通过这个接口标准调用源代码 。这个接口标准被称为开放API 。
【api是什么的缩写 api是什么】以上是对什么是api及其简称的介绍 。不知道你有没有找到你需要的资料?如果你想了解更多这方面的内容,记得收藏并关注这个网站 。
推荐阅读
- 霜树尽空枝肠断丁香结的意思诗意
- kg是什么单位是斤还是公斤?KG是什么计量单位怎么换算?
- 计算日期之间天数?算日子的软件?
- 雨的拼音怎么写?多少的朵的拼音?
- 鲁肃上了孔明的船下一句?鲁肃上孔明的船歇后语
- 星的拼音怎么写 星的拼音
- 我爱你韩文怎么写的 我爱你韩文怎么写
- 香辣小龙虾的做法大全家常视频 香辣小龙虾的做法
- 着的部首和结构 着的部首
- 形容观众多的成语有哪些 形容观众多的成语